    The Body Size-Dependent Diet Composition of North American Sea Ducks in Winter

    Daily food requirements scale with body mass and activity in animals. While small species of birds have higher mass-specific field metabolic rates than larger species, larger species have higher absolute energy costs. Under energy balance, we thus expect the small species to have a higher energy value diet. Also the weight and time constraints for flighted and diurnal foragers should set a maximum to the amount of prey items taken in one meal and to the daily number of meals, respectively. Further, avoidance of competition causes the species to reduce the amount of shared prey in their diet. Some diet segregation is therefore to be expected between species. We tested these hypotheses and investigated the role of body mass in the diet composition of 12 sea duck species (Somateria mollissima, Somateria spectabilis, Somateria fischeri, Polysticta stelleri, Bucephala clangula, Bucephala islandica, Bucephala albeola, Melanitta nigra, Melanitta perspicillata, Melanitta deglandi, Histrionicus histrionicus and Clangula hyemalis) wintering in North America. This study was based on a literature survey with special emphasis given to the diet data from the former US Bureau of Biological Survey. The data supported our hypothesis that the energy value of winter diet of sea ducks scales negatively with body mass. Diet diversity also scaled negatively with body mass. Our results suggest the existence of a minimum for the energy value of avian diets

    The use of Amerindian charm plants in the Guianas

    Background: Magical charm plants to ensure good luck in hunting, fishing, agriculture, love and warfare are known among many Amerindians groups in the Guianas. Documented by anthropologists as social and political markers and exchangeable commodities, these charms have received little attention by ethnobotanists, as they are surrounded by secrecy and are difficult to identify. We compared the use of charm species among indigenous groups in the Guianas to see whether similarity in charm species was related to geographical or cultural proximity. We hypothesized that cultivated plants were more widely shared than wild ones and that charms with underground bulbs were more widely used than those without such organs, as vegetatively propagated plants would facilitate transfer of charm knowledge. Methods: We compiled a list of charm plants from recent fieldwork and supplemented these with information from herbarium collections, historic and recent literature among 11 ethnic groups in the Guianas. To assess similarity in plant use among these groups, we performed a Detrended Component Analysis (DCA) on species level. To see whether cultivated plants or vegetatively propagated species were more widely shared among ethnic groups than wild species or plants without rhizomes, tubers or stem-rooting capacity, we used an independent sample t-test. Results: We recorded 366 charms, representing 145 species. The majority were hunting charms, wild plants, propagated via underground bulbs and grown in villages. Our data suggest that similarity in charm species is associated with geographical proximity and not cultural relatedness. The most widely shared species, used by all Amerindian groups, is Caladium bicolor. The tubers of this plant facilitate easy transport and its natural variability allows for associations with a diversity of game animals. Human selection on shape, size and color of plants through clonal reproduction has ensured the continuity of morphological traits and their correlation with animal features. Conclusions: Charm plants serve as vehicles for traditional knowledge on animal behavior, tribal warfare and other aspects of oral history and should therefore deserve more scientific and societal attention, especially because there are indications that traditional knowledge on charms is disappearing
